Game Recap: Men's Basketball | | Tim Calderwood

Second Half Powers Men's Hoops to Non-Conference Win

LISLE, IL - The Benedictine University men's basketball team scored 50 points in the second half and erased a 12-point deficit to score a home non-conference victory over Wabash.

FINAL SCORE
Benedictine 76, Wabash 59

THE DETAILS
•
Benedictine scored the first points of the game on a Chris Hester from jumper, one of the only first half leads for the hosts
• Leading by a point midway through the first half Wabash used a 9-0 run to open a double-digit advantage at 22-12 as Benedictine went cold from the field
• Wabash led 29-17 with 3:10 left in the half
• Benedictine pulled within five at 29-24 with just under two minutes left in the first on a basket from Anthony Lynch following a turnover and trailed 31-26 at the break
• The visitors scored the first four points of the second half and led by nine before a 7-0 spurt from Benedictine keyed by a three-pointer from Nick Kosich cut the deficit down to just two points at 37-35 with 15:31 remaining
• Kosich tied the game at 40 with another three-pointer at the 13:03 mark
• Marvin Agwomoh gave Benedictine their first lead since early in the opening half with a dunk
• Agwomoh added an exclamation point with a one-handed slam to make the score 46-42 with 11:29 to play
• The second dunk was part of a 9-0 run that made the score 51-42 at the halfway point of the second
• Cade Ellingson splashed home a three-pointer to kick off a 10-0 run that turned the game into a 63-46 edge with just over six minutes left
• Wabash drew within 10 with 2:51 left before a three from Trevor Montiel helped to ice the win as Benedictine scored the final seven points

STAT LEADERS
•
After shooting just 32 percent in the first half, Benedictine scorched the nets at 60 percent in the second half and connected on six three-pointers
• Wabash tuned the ball over just 14 times, but Benedictine produced 16 points off the miscues
• The defense held Wabash to just 31 percent in the second half and 38.6 percent for the game
• Benedictine is one of the top defenses in the nation this season
• Kosich led four players in double figures with 13 points with Hester and Agwomoh tallying 12
• Ellingson notched 10 off the bench as the reserves scored 34 points
• Montiel grabbed 11 rebounds as Benedictine finished +6 on the glass
